Correct. $20 is the minimum to withdraw from ClixSense to Payoneer. However, Payoneer has their own internal limits, while you might be able to cash out $20 from CS into your Payoneer account, in order to transfer your Payoneer balance to your bank account you will need minimum $50 or whatever minimums Payoneer has in place depending on your country.

EXAMPLE:

Your ClixSense balance is $20, y ou can cash out $20 to your Payoneer
You receive your Payoneer cash and you have $20 to your Payoneer balance, but you cannot transfer it to your bank unless your Payoneer balance is minimum $50 (or whatever is indicated based on your country).
